Took my little point and shoot to the mountains and got some photos. Couldn't take this one fully my self though.

I preset the camera, told my buddy where to stand and got him to click the shutter. Whalah.

I don't think it turned out to bad so thought I would share. This was taken going down the peak run. Was about a 45 minute hike to the top.
